Can I mix water with my foundation?

To make the foundation blend easier
If you want to avoid a streaky makeup look, then mixing water with your foundation is something worth trying out. Adding water to your foundation is one of the best ways to achieve an even coverage that looks natural and healthy on the face.

What can I mix my foundation with?

Mixing one part of moisturizer into two parts of foundation makes all the difference when it comes to your final makeup look! It gives the skin a beautiful and dewy finish that looks so natural. Try this trick if you have a matte foundation that looks too dry and powdery.

How do you fix dry foundation?

Use a damp beauty blender or other beauty sponge to dilute and soften the excess makeup. Apply by using stippling motions to blend out the foundation around your hairline, cheeks and t-zone. If you feel that your foundation looks dry and cracked, change to a different formula or mix it with a nourishing beauty oil.

What can I use if I run out of setting spray?

To make a setting spray with aloe vera gel, just combine 2 tablespoons of aloe vera gel with 2-3 drops of lavender oil and 1 ½ cups of water in a sterilized spray bottle, and shake the ingredients to combine.

Is setting spray just water?

Setting spray is a liquid mist, with water and alcohol typically as its main ingredients, that can be used to increase the lifespan of your makeup look, preventing fading and smudging.

What can you do with leftover foundation?

Try this! Take a few pumps of your favorite moisturizer and an equal number pumps of your favorite foundation. Mix them together on the back of your hand and apply to your face with a damp sponge or brush. The moisturizer will help dilute the color, so your fave foundation has more of a tinted moisturizer effect.

How do you make homemade makeup setting spray?

Aloe Setting Spray
  1. Step 1- Start by taking half a cup of water in a container.
  2. Step 2- Now add 1-2 tablespoons of aloe vera gel. ...
  3. Step 3- Add 4-5 drops of glycerin to the mixture. ...
  4. Step 4- Lastly, add 1-2 tablespoon of rose water. ...
  5. Step 5- Pour everything into the spray bottle and make sure you leave some space at the top.

Why does my skin look so dry when I put foundation on?

Silicone-based foundations can cling to dry patches, making your skin look uneven and patchy. Water-based foundations are more moisturizing and have a dewy finish. Stell recommends staying away from foundations that are matte or full coverage.
